What Is a Python Compiler Online?
A Python compiler online is a cloud-based tool that allows you to write, compile, and run Python code directly from your browser. You don’t need to download or install any software — everything happens in a web-based interface. It provides a ready-to-use Python environment where you can focus on coding instead of setup.
This type of tool is ideal for situations where speed and accessibility are important, such as practicing Python concepts, running quick tests, or debugging snippets of code.

2. Security in the Cloud
Security is a major concern in today’s digital landscape. A reliable online Python compiler takes user data seriously. Modern compilers are built on secure cloud platforms that protect your code and personal data from unauthorized access. Features such as encrypted connections, sandboxed environments, and limited data storage help ensure a safe coding experience.
This is crucial for professionals working on sensitive projects or students submitting assignments online.

4. Cross-Device Compatibility
Because an online Python compiler runs in the browser, it works across all major operating systems — Windows, macOS, Linux, and even mobile platforms. This allows you to code from virtually any device. Whether you’re switching between a laptop and a tablet or coding from your phone while on the move, the flexibility is unmatched.
This feature is especially beneficial for students and remote workers who may not always have access to the same computer.
